What is a Financial Model?

A financial model is like a structural map for money. It demonstrates how money may move in the future. Financial Models use past data, facts, and assumptions to make predictions. Businesses and individuals use these models to make smart financial decisions related to their projects, costs, and profits. The models follow a step-by-step procedure to provide clear results. These results can be tested in different situations and scenarios. Some of the important facts related to Financial Models are as follows:

  • A financial model is built using data and assumptions.

  • It helps in planning profits, costs, and risks.

  • Models are often created in spreadsheets using formulas.

  • They allow people to test ideas before making big choices.

Types of Financial Models

Financial models can be built in several different forms, each for a particular purpose. Every model acts like a different tool. Some models are simple and focus only on costs, whereas others are very detailed and connect all financial statements. The details related to types of financial models are provided in the table below:

Types of Financial Models
Types Details
Three-statement model Connects the income statement, balance sheet, and cash flow. Gives a full picture of a company’s money
Discounted Cash Flow (DCF)  Used to find the present value of a business by looking at future cash flows
Merger and Acquisition (M&A) Used when one company plans to buy another to check if the deal will work
Initial Public Offering (IPO) Helps in setting the right price when a company wants to sell its shares to the public
Budget model Used for planning yearly expenses and keeping control of spending
Forecasting model Predicts how the company may perform in the future. Useful for long-term planning
Leveraged Buyout (LBO) Used when a company is bought mostly with borrowed money. Checks if the deal will give good returns

Components of Financial Modeling

A financial model is a well-structured system that combines different parts to demonstrate how the money or funds associated with a company may move in the future.  Components are important because the model cannot be accurate or useful without them. The different components of any financial model are as follows:

Components of Financial Models
Components Details
Input Data and numbers like sales, costs, or growth rates
Assumptions Guesses made on facts
Statements Income statement, balance sheet, and cash flow statement
Formulas to calculate totals, profits, and losses
Outputs Show results like future earnings or company value
Scenarios Different cases (good, normal, bad) to check possible outcomes

Process of Financial Modeling

Building a financial model follows a step-by-step process. Each part of the process must be performed carefully to get accurate results. Through the step-by-step procedure, a strong financial model system can be built that predicts results and supports in making important financial decisions. The process to build a financial model is as follows:

  • Collect Data – Gather past sales, costs, and other records.

  • Make Assumptions – Create logical guesses about future growth.

  • Build Structure – Organize the model step by step with reports.

  • Add Formulas – Insert calculations for totals and results.

  • Test Model – Check carefully for mistakes.

  • Use Model – Apply the finished model for projects, loans, or investments.

Common Mistakes in Financial Modeling

While financial models are very useful, they can fail sometimes due to certain human errors. Even a single mistake can lead to false predictions and poor decisions. It is important to know the common mistakes so they can be avoided. Some of the most common mistakes are as follows:

  • Wrong formulas that give false results.

  • Overuse of assumptions without facts.

  • Making the model too complex.

  • Ignoring unusual events like crises.

  • Forgetting to test results with different scenarios.

Limitations of Financial Models

Even though financial models are very helpful, they are not perfect. Their work is heavily dependent on the data and assumptions provided. Inaccurate date input may result in the building up of an inaccurate model. These models also cannot always predict any sudden events like global crises or natural disasters. They have to be updated regularly to stay useful and relevant. 

  • Results depend on assumptions, and wrong guesses give wrong results.

  • Cannot predict sudden events like disasters.
    Too much detail can make them hard to use.

  • Need regular updates to stay useful.
